The End of Everything

A world eroded by terror,

the crow caws for thee,

the vulture strips your bones,

whilst the raven sings you to sleep.

You hang onto life so dearly,

though the sun left earth long ago

to rot under moonlight,

oh, how we once worshipped

those pearly beams.

The soil crumbles beneath your feet,

an infested mix of dirt and ash,

still you toil forth,

a quest embarked without destination,

each step extinguishing hope.

But what else is there to do?

Apocalypse survivor, what is there left?

And so face to face with nothingness,

the crow caws for thee,

the vulture strips your bones,

whilst the raven sings you to sleep.
